Lafayette sits in the heart of Cajun Country, 130 miles from the Gulf Coast — close enough for tropical storm damage, far enough for sustained wind damage across residential and commercial roofs. The 490,000-person metro averages 60+ inches of rainfall annually, which keeps roofing maintenance demand high year-round. For roofers, Lafayette offers both storm-driven surges and steady baseline work.
Lafayette's Roofing Market
Lafayette's roofing demand is influenced by its oil and gas economy. When energy prices are strong, home values rise, renovations increase, and roofing demand follows. When prices drop, deferred maintenance creates a backlog of needed repairs. Either way, the work exists — the question is answering the phone when it calls.
Tropical weather exposure adds the surge element. Even a weak tropical system produces 50–70 mph winds that strip shingles, damage flashing, and create leak issues across thousands of homes. Post-storm call volume can spike 300–800% in 48 hours.

Year-Round Rainfall Demand
With 60+ inches of annual rainfall, Lafayette roofs take constant punishment. Shingle deterioration, flashing failures, soffit rot, and gutter damage create maintenance demand throughout the year. This baseline revenue keeps the pipeline full between storm events. AI answering captures both the steady calls and the surges.
